Topic guide

How to approach patterns and sequences

A sequence follows a rule from one term to the next. Arithmetic patterns add or subtract a constant amount, while other patterns may multiply, alternate, or use position-based rules.

Compare consecutive terms before predicting. A valid rule must explain every displayed transition, not only the final pair.

Worked example

Follow the reasoning step by step

Continue 5, 9, 13, ___, ___.

  1. Find 9 − 5 = 4.
  2. Confirm 13 − 9 = 4.
  3. Add 4 to 13 to get 17.
  4. Add 4 again to get 21.

Solution: 17, 21; the rule is add 4.

Error check

Common mistakes to watch for

  • Using a rule that fits only one step
  • Changing between addition and multiplication without evidence
  • Counting positions as terms
